Package: wnpp
Severity: whishlist

URL:
  http://jakarta.apache.org/avalon/

License:
	Apache (BSD Style)

Description: 

 The Avalon framework consists of interfaces that define
 relationships between commonly used application components,
 best-of-practice pattern enforcements, and several lightweight
 convenience implementations of the generic components.
